Hi
 
I'm using FlashMX 2004 Pro and I am making a data entry form where I grab date and time to store in a db.
 
The DateField works really well for the date part, but I need a locked-down TimeField to grab the time with.
 
How have you done this before?
 
I was thinking of using a couple of numeric steppers, but that doesn't really work because you can't have leading zeroes.  I don't really want to use combo or list boxes if it can be avoided.
 
Any tips greatly appreciated.
